Elephone P8 2017 specifications

BrandElephone
NameP8 2017
ModelP82017
Release date2017

Weight, dimensions, colors

Weight6.56 oz
Dimensions6.06 x 2.97 x 0.37 inch
Colorsblack, gold, red
SIM typeNano SIM

The weight of Elephone P8 2017 is about 6.56 oz with battery. This is average for smartphones of the same size. Smartphones use a Nano SIM as a small chipcard for a subscriber identity module (SIM).

System, chipset, performance

OS versionAndroid OS v7.0 (Nougat)
SoCMediatek Helio P25 MT6757T
CPUOcta-core, Quad-core 2.5 GHz Cortex-A53, Quad-core 1.4 GHz Cortex-A53
GPUMali-T880 MP2

The Elephone P8 2017 comes with Android OS v7.0 (Nougat) out of the box. The Android operating system uses the Linux kernel as its foundation. It includes a user interface, middleware, and many pre-installed applications. An advanced scheduler manages this octa-core CPU. It assigns tasks to the CPU for real-time speed and power efficiency. Many mobile devices use ARM Mali GPUs. They are well known for their good performance and power efficiency.

Display type, size, resolution

Display typeIPS
Screen size5.5 inch
Resolution1080 x 1920 px
Multitouch supportyes

The 5.5 inch IPS display has better features. These include optimal viewing angles, color accuracy, and unchanging color reproduction. The 5.5 inch display make this smartphone pocket-friendly. The size of the screen is measured diagonally, from corner to corner.

Memory, storage

RAM6 GB
Internal storage64 GB
Memory card slotmicroSD

The Elephone P8 2017 comes with 6 GB of RAM, which is considered to be sufficient for most users' needs. The needed RAM amount for good performance depends on factors. These include the OS, the apps, and the services we use. 64 GB of storage is usually seen as good for a smartphone. It should be enough for most users. We can expand the internal storage (64 GB) with a compatible microSD card.

Battery type, capacity, charger

TypeLi-Po 3600 mAh, non-removable

The Li-Po 3600 mAh, non-removable battery gives the smartphone a good battery backup. The lithium polymer (Li-Po) battery is a light-weight, rechargeable battery. The battery of P8 2017 isn't removable without voiding the warranty.
